Thanks to everyone who is interested in it. I can tell you this right now. You will need to install HamWeather and have it running in a sub directory on your site. So those that are interested you can go ahead and download it and get it set up and running as the template gets the data from HW program…

One other thing you are going to need is the Database for the locations whether it be the flatfile or MySQL. The one with the install only contains limited locations. So until you purchase the DB it will not work because all your locations will show N/A. So everyone has to ask themselves if this is really worth it just for this one script? In my case it is because I use HW through out my site. So this may or may not be for you.

What is the cost of these flat files/MySQL databases and ae they re-occurring costs?

$20 a month, but you only need it once. Then you can pay to update it once a year if you like.
